Favorable Investment Climate

The Italian real estate market has demonstrated resilience and growth, with residential property prices increasing steadily over the years. Foreign investors can purchase, sell, and rent out real estate without restrictions, enjoying the same rights as Italian nationals. This openness, combined with Italy’s strategic location and high quality of life, makes it an appealing choice for international investors  .

Tax Incentives and Residency Options

Italy offers attractive tax incentives for foreign investors, including flat tax regimes for retirees and favorable conditions for returning professionals. These incentives, coupled with the possibility of obtaining residency through investment, enhance the appeal of investing in Italian real estate  .
